Under the general direction of the Contracts Manager, prepares, administers, and coordinates solicitations and contracts and is the liaison and primary contact between assigned DFW Business Unit(s) and Contract Administrator(s) in interpreting and complying with airport policies and applicable Procurement Laws.
This position will work to improve communication between the Procurement and Materials Management department and other DFW Business Units.
Bachelor’s degree in business, supply chain management, or public administration or related technical/engineering field. Five (5) years of progressively responsible experience administering construction, general goods, services, or professional service contracts.
Experience in negotiating new contracts and modifications/changes to existing contracts.
Any equivalent combination of education and/or experience may be substituted for the above. Possession of a valid Class C driver’s license.
